What Does "Finishing Strong" Really Mean?
Finishing strong transcends simply completing a task; it encompasses a mindset and a set of actions. It means pushing beyond your perceived limitations, maintaining focus and determination despite obstacles, and delivering your best work, regardless of the circumstances. It's about resilience, grit, and unwavering commitment to excellence. It's about the quality of your effort, not just the outcome.

How to Finish Strong: Practical Strategies
Now that we've established the importance of finishing strong, let's explore some practical strategies to help you achieve it:
1. Set Clear Goals and Break Them Down:
Having well-defined goals provides direction and purpose. Break down large goals into smaller, more manageable tasks, making the overall objective less daunting. This fosters a sense of accomplishment as you complete each step, boosting motivation to keep going.
2. Visualize Success:
Mental rehearsal can significantly enhance performance. Visualize yourself successfully completing your goal, focusing on the positive emotions and sensations associated with achievement. This mental preparation builds confidence and resilience.
3. Develop a Strong Support System:
Surround yourself with positive and encouraging people who believe in you and your abilities. Their support can provide motivation and encouragement during challenging times.
4. Practice Self-Care:
Prioritize your physical and mental well-being. Adequate sleep, proper nutrition, and regular exercise are essential for maintaining energy levels and focus. Stress management techniques, such as mindfulness or meditation, can also help.
5. Embrace Challenges as Opportunities for Growth:
View setbacks and obstacles not as roadblocks but as opportunities for learning and growth. Analyze what went wrong, adjust your approach, and move forward with renewed determination.
6. Celebrate Your Wins:
Acknowledge and celebrate your achievements, no matter how small. This positive reinforcement boosts morale and motivates you to continue striving for excellence.
